| // <string> |
| |
| // basic_string substr(size_type pos = 0, size_type n = npos) const; // constexpr since C++20, removed in C++23 |
| // basic_string substr(size_type pos = 0, size_type n = npos) const&; // since in C++23 |
| |
| #include <string> |
| #include <stdexcept> |
| #include <algorithm> |
| #include <cassert> |
| |
| #include "test_allocator.h" |
| #include "test_macros.h" |
| #include "min_allocator.h" |
| #include "asan_testing.h" |
| |
| template <class S> |
| TEST_CONSTEXPR_CXX20 void test(const S& s, typename S::size_type pos, typename S::size_type n) { |
| if (pos <= s.size()) { |
| S str = s.substr(pos, n); |
| LIBCPP_ASSERT(str.__invariants()); |
| assert(pos <= s.size()); |
| typename S::size_type rlen = std::min(n, s.size() - pos); |
| assert(str.size() == rlen); |
| assert(S::traits_type::compare(s.data() + pos, str.data(), rlen) == 0); |
| LIBCPP_ASSERT(is_string_asan_correct(s)); |
| LIBCPP_ASSERT(is_string_asan_correct(str)); |
| } |
| #ifndef TEST_HAS_NO_EXCEPTIONS |
| else if (!TEST_IS_CONSTANT_EVALUATED) { |
| try { |
| S str = s.substr(pos, n); |
| assert(false); |
| } catch (std::out_of_range&) { |
| assert(pos > s.size()); |
| } |
| } |
| #endif |
| } |
